man vs tldr: كيفية استخدام أمر tldr في Linux


لتجنب أي لبس، يجب أن أذكر أولاً أن هذه المقالة تتناول man و tldr الأوامر في لينكس. على الرغم من أن صفحات الدليل مفصلة بشكل لا يصدق، إلا أنها يمكن أن تكون مخيفة، خاصة بالنسبة لأولئك الذين بدأوا للتو. بدلاً من ذلك، يمكنك استخدام الأمر tldr للحصول على شرح قصير وبسيط وسهل الفهم لأي أمر Linux.

في هذا الدليل، سوف نتعمق في ما tldr هو كيفية استخدامه، ولماذا هو بديل أفضل للتقليدي man يأمر.

أمر الرجل

ال man الأمر، المشار إليه بالدليل، هو الطريقة التقليدية للوصول إلى وثائق الأوامر في أنظمة التشغيل المشابهة لـ Unix. عندما تكتب man جنبًا إلى جنب مع الأمر، يقوم بسحب صفحة الدليل الخاصة بهذا الأمر المحدد، مما يوفر معلومات مفصلة حول استخدامه وخياراته وأمثلة.

على سبيل المثال، يمكنك الحصول على نظرة عامة مفصلة عن ls الأمر عن طريق تنفيذ هذا:

عرض أمر Ls باستخدام أمر Man

يؤدي هذا إلى فتح صفحة يدوية تسرد جميع الخيارات المتاحة. يتم تنظيم المعلومات في أقسام مثل اسم, ملخص, وصف, خيارات، و أمثلة. على الرغم من أن هذا الهيكل يجعل من السهل التنقل فيه، إلا أنه يمكن أن يكون واسع النطاق أيضًا.

ال man يمكن أن يكون الأمر مفيدًا بشكل لا يصدق للمستخدمين المتقدمين الذين يحتاجون إلى معرفة متعمقة، ولكنه قد يبدو وكأنه يخوض في كمية هائلة من النص للمبتدئين أو حتى للمستخدمين المتوسطين. يمكن للحجم الهائل من المعلومات أن يربكك، ويمكن أن تضل طريقك فيه بسهولة.

ما هو تلدر؟

tldr يقف لفترة طويلة جدا. لم أقرأ، عبارة نشأت على الإنترنت لوصف ملخص لمقطع نصي طويل. على عكس صفحات الرجل، تركز صفحات tldr على الخيارات الأكثر فائدة وتوفر أمثلة واضحة وواقعية.

على سبيل المثال، عند تشغيل tldr ls في الوحدة الطرفية، سيزودك الأمر tldr بنظرة عامة موجزة عن الملف ls الأمر، إلى جانب بعض خياراته الأكثر استخدامًا:

عرض معلومات الأمر ls بما في ذلك المثال الخاص به باستخدام الأمر tldr.

كما ترون، تعد صفحات tldr أكثر إيجازًا ووضوحًا، مما يسهل على المستخدمين الجدد فهم الأمر بسرعة والبدء في استخدامه.

كيفية استخدام تلدر

للوصول إلى صفحات tldr بسهولة، قم بتثبيت عميل مدعوم. أحد العملاء الرئيسيين هو Node.js، الذي يعمل بمثابة العميل الأصلي لمشروع tldr. لاستكشاف تطبيقات العميل الأخرى المتاحة لمنصات مختلفة، يمكنك الرجوع إلى صفحة wiki الخاصة بعملاء TLDR.

يمكنك تثبيت Node.js باستخدام مدير الحزم المطابق لتوزيع Linux الخاص بك. على سبيل المثال، في التوزيعات المستندة إلى Debian مثل Linux Mint أو Ubuntu، قم بتشغيل هذا:

sudo apt install nodejs npm

بمجرد تثبيت Node.js ومدير الحزم الخاص به npm، يمكنك تثبيت عميل tldr عالميًا عن طريق تشغيل هذا:

تثبيت Tldr باستخدام Npm

إذا كنت تفضل ذلك، يمكنك أيضًا تثبيت tldr كحزمة Snap عن طريق تنفيذ الأمر التالي:

بعد التثبيت، يتيح لك عميل tldr عرض إصدارات مبسطة وسهلة الفهم لصفحات دليل سطر الأوامر. على سبيل المثال، للحصول على ملخص موجز لل tar الأمر، اكتب ببساطة:

عرض أمر Tar باستخدام Tldr

يمكنك أيضًا البحث عن أوامر محددة باستخدام الكلمات الأساسية ذات الامتداد --search خيار:

بالإضافة إلى ذلك، يمكنك سرد كافة الأوامر المتاحة باستخدام -l خيار:

يمكنك أيضًا الركض ببساطة tldr في الوحدة الطرفية لاستكشاف جميع خيارات أوامر tldr الأخرى:

خيارات أمر Tldr

إذا كنت تفضل تجربة تعتمد على المتصفح، فإن موقع tldr الرسمي يقدم نفس المحتوى بتنسيق سهل الاستخدام على الويب. يتضمن ميزات مثل شريط البحث مع الإكمال التلقائي والتسميات التي تشير إلى ما إذا كان الأمر خاصًا بنظام Linux أو macOS.

صفحة متصفح الويب Tldr

علاوة على ذلك، ترتبط كل صفحة مساعدة أيضًا بمصدرها على GitHub، حيث يمكنك اقتراح تعديلات أو تحسينات باستخدام أدوات GitHub المضمنة – لا داعي لتعلم Git.

لماذا Tldr أفضل من الرجل

تم تصميم صفحات tldr لتكون سهلة القراءة والفهم. إنهم يقطعون الفوضى، ويقدمون فقط المعلومات الأكثر أهمية للبدء في الأمر.

على عكس صفحات الدليل، التي تتضمن غالبًا كل الخيارات والتفاصيل الممكنة، تركز صفحات tldr على الأمثلة العملية. توضح هذه الأمثلة كيف يمكنك استخدام الأمر في سيناريوهات العالم الحقيقي، مما يسهل تطبيق ما تعلمته.

يعمل tldr على منصات متعددة، بما في ذلك Windows وmacOS وLinux، مما يجعله أداة متعددة الاستخدامات يمكنك استخدامها في أي مكان.

التفاف

سواء كنت مبتدئًا يتطلع إلى البدء بسرعة أو مستخدمًا متقدمًا يحتاج إلى تجديد سريع، فإن tldr يعد إضافة ممتازة لمجموعة أدواتك.

ومع ذلك، تذكر أن الأمر tldr ليس بديلاً كاملاً لصفحات الدليل. للحصول على فهم تقني عميق، احتفظ دائمًا بالصفحات اليدوية التقليدية كمرجع شامل.

حقوق الصورة: أونسبلاش. جميع التعديلات ولقطات الشاشة بواسطة Haroon Javed.

اشترك في النشرة الإخبارية لدينا!

يتم تسليم أحدث البرامج التعليمية لدينا مباشرة إلى صندوق البريد الوارد الخاص بك

هارون جافيد

هارون هو من عشاق التكنولوجيا مدى الحياة ويتمتع بخبرة تزيد عن خمس سنوات في كتابة آلاف المقالات حول Linux ولغات البرمجة والمزيد. يحب استكشاف التقنيات الجديدة وتجربتها لإيجاد طرق مبتكرة لاستخدامها. وقد تم عرض أعمال هارون على العديد من المنصات عبر الإنترنت، بما في ذلك HTG، وBaeldung، وLinuxHint.

اترك تعليقاً

لن يتم نشر عنوان بريدك الإلكتروني. الحقول الإلزامية مشار إليها بـ *

زر الذهاب إلى الأعلى